I disagree.

I think KD is the best offensive player in the League. Curry is off to an amazing start but I think KD has eclipsed James as the League's best offensive threat.

Steph and KD are great scorers, both top 4 obviously but I think you are underestimating the fact neither can be double-teamed, they also can rest more bc their team is stacked. KD has always been efficent but you notice it is higher than ever on GS, he is an elite scorer regardless but a lot harder to create offense when you are being double teamed or hammered every time you go to the rim like Lebron. Lebron hasnt been shooting great early from outside this year but he is with a new team, let the chemizstry develop more
